What is Unrar_IObitDel.dll?
A DLL (Dynamic Link Library) file is a type of file that contains code and data that can be used by multiple programs at the same time. The unrar_IObitDel.dll file is a specific DLL file that is related to the software IObit Malware Fighter 3. This file plays a crucial role in the functioning of the software by providing necessary functions and resources that are used by IObit Malware Fighter 3 to perform specific tasks related to unrar (uncompressing) operations.
In the context of IObit Malware Fighter 3, the unrar_IObitDel.dll file is particularly important as it enables the software to handle unrar operations effectively. It allows IObit Malware Fighter 3 to extract and analyze compressed files for potential malware, providing an essential function in the software's overall malware detection and removal capabilities. Therefore, the unrar_IObitDel.dll file is integral to the proper functioning of IObit Malware Fighter 3 and contributes significantly to its ability to protect the computer system from potential security threats.

Run the Windows Check Disk Utility
In this guide, we will explain how to use the Check Disk Utility to fix unrar_IObitDel.dll errors.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Command Prompt
in the search bar and press Enter. -
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.
-
In the Command Prompt window, type
chkdsk /f
and press Enter. -
If the system reports that it cannot run the check because the disk is in use, type
Y
and press Enter to schedule the check for the next system restart.
-
If you had to schedule the check, restart your computer for the check to be performed.
Run the Windows Memory Diagnostic Tool
How to run a Windows Memory Diagnostic test. If the unrar_IObitDel.dll error is related to memory issues it should resolve the problem.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Windows Memory Diagnostic
in the search bar and press Enter.
-
In the Windows Memory Diagnostic window, click on Restart now and check for problems (recommended).
-
Your computer will restart and the memory diagnostic will run automatically. It might take some time.
-
After the diagnostic, your computer will restart again. You can check the results in the notification area on your desktop.
